At just under a million acres burned, the Dixie Fire reshaped the landscape of Northern California in 2021. As the fire was actively burning and shifting Bethel Global Response deployed its new Mercy Chefs kitchen trailer used in tandem with a local commercial kitchen to serve over 7,000 hot nutritious meals to local responders and evacuees. This was led in under the collaboration of our feeding partner in the disaster response field Mercy Chefs.
